Transaction baa8437eb11f97417a0b126878a2e2556afb21854eaf75562db7157096d9cabc
1 Input
1 Output
-
baa8437eb11f97417a0b126878a2e2556afb21854eaf75562db7157096d9cabc:0
- value
- 8577988
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 444837d607a6f3c20db4fca6c45ce9e4f5b4d5d5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17E3Tr7GW1Yc9gtWJTJadN6id4KMuqbnRb